Output 8e688293e0db323a812c0638cf0aee86162c2f751e308a7bf0e2e7ca8157c891:5

value
10564892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060c9313a80abcd849772397896dbef979192aca OP_EQUAL
address
32F13PSBGjJkyFUS9FDox4q3ycse46hpGf
transaction
8e688293e0db323a812c0638cf0aee86162c2f751e308a7bf0e2e7ca8157c891
spent
true